New play opening in Burbank

Table of the Heart graphic

A live theater production of the Christmas play, “Table of the Heart,” is set to open tomorrow, December 10, at the Media City Church 269 East Providencia Avenue in the Media City.

The production is written and directed by Tatum Shank. The play tells the story of the tragedy and triumph of the Carmichael family who move from Los Angeles to Seattle and quickly are faced with heartbreaking circumstances that they must overcome. The theme, forgiveness leads to healing.

Producer, Jennifer Shank, says this is an exclusive two week run of “Table of the Heart.” Performances are Saturdays, December 10 and 17 at 8 p.m. and Sundays, December 11 and 18 at 7 p.m. Tickets are $5 in advance and $8 at the door.
